@lina_wxs Try using Revo Uninstaller (the free version is fine) to remove Sims 4. Before doing so, rename the Sims 4 folder inside Documents > Electronic Arts to something that doesn't include "Sims 4" in the name so Revo doesn't flag it for deletion. Uninstall the EA App with Revo as well, for good measure.
If Revo can't "see" Sims 4 at all, then the alternative is to manually delete the folder that contains the game's program files, and use Piriform's CCleaner (the free version is also fine) to delete the associated registry entries and other hidden files.
If this doesn't help, or you want to try something else before you go through the trouble of reinstalling the game, the steps in the first post of this thread, which is for a related but distinct error, may be useful:
